This is an automated email from the ASF dual-hosted git repository.
ebakke pushed a change to branch master
in repository https://gitbox.apache.org/repos/asf/netbeans.git.
from 6417f2f Merge pull request #1281 from jglick/NbEventSpy-NETBEANS-2639
new b8312bd Replace 'new ImageIcon' with image2Icon for commonly visible
icons.
new d7d467c Use Icon.paintIcon instead of Graphics.drawImage (one
example).
new d305cd1 [NETBEANS-1586] Make ImageUtilities.createDisabledIcon work
with HiDPI icons
new 44822cd Adjust data types in ImageUtilities to make it easier to see
where ToolTipImage is being passed around.
new 0f61cd9 Make ImageUtilities handle scalable Icon implementations.
new 894376f Improve rendering quality of scaled bitmap icons on HiDPI
displays.
new c6bf0a5 Support HiDPI icons from ImageUtilities.mergeImages.
new 73a3f68 Fix a few comment typos.
new 5f828b3 Don't have CachedHiDPIIcon extend from ImageIcon.
new 5f78200 Add more tests for ImageUtilities, and fix some broken ones.
The 10 revisions listed above as "new" are entirely new to this
repository and will be described in separate emails. The revisions
listed as "add" were already present in the repository and have only
been added to this reference.
Summary of changes:
.../editor/breadcrumbs/BreadCrumbComponent.java | 15 +-
.../src/org/netbeans/modules/java/ui/Icons.java | 4 +-
.../jshell/editor/CommandCompletionProvider.java | 2 +-
.../org/netbeans/core/windows/view/EditorView.java | 2 +-
.../core/windows/view/ui/TabbedHandler.java | 5 +-
.../windows/view/ui/slides/TabbedSlideAdapter.java | 4 +-
.../view/ui/tabcontrol/AbstractTabbedImpl.java | 3 +-
.../core/windows/view/ui/toolbars/DnDSupport.java | 2 +-
.../core/windows/view/ui/toolbars/ToolbarRow.java | 4 +-
.../explorer/view/NodeRenderDataProvider.java | 4 +-
.../src/org/openide/util/CachedHiDPIIcon.java | 210 +++++++++++++
.../src/org/openide/util/FilteredIcon.java | 79 +++++
.../src/org/openide/util/ImageUtilities.java | 342 +++++++++++++++------
.../src/org/openide/util/VectorIcon.java | 2 +-
.../src/org/openide/util/ImageUtilitiesTest.java | 234 +++++++++++++-
15 files changed, 786 insertions(+), 126 deletions(-)
create mode 100644
platform/openide.util.ui/src/org/openide/util/CachedHiDPIIcon.java
create mode 100644
platform/openide.util.ui/src/org/openide/util/FilteredIcon.java
---------------------------------------------------------------------
To unsubscribe, e-mail: [email protected]
For additional commands, e-mail: [email protected]
For further information about the NetBeans mailing lists, visit:
https://cwiki.apache.org/confluence/display/NETBEANS/Mailing+lists